Gas leak detection is an important part of every plant safety program. Many industrial processes require the use of potentially toxic gases and other processes may generate hazardous gases as a byproduct. Such hazards can be managed through careful equipment maintenance and regular monitoring for early signs of leakage.

The Series C16 PortaSens II portable gas leak detector is a versatile tool for performing regular leak checks in gas storage areas, around process equipment and piping, or in confined spaces prior to entry. Designed for easy one-hand operation, the detector contains an internal sample pump and a flexible sampling wand to allow pinpoint location of the source of leakage. A large character display insures that measured values are easily visible, and a back-light for the display insures readability in low or no light conditions.

Receiver modules provide the electronic brains for the detection and alarm system. Each compact module includes a digital display of gas concentration, isolated analog output,and 4 relay outputs. Receivers may be located up to 1000 feet from sensor/transmitters for remote indication, or can provide local control function such as valve shutoff while transmitting a 4-20 mA signal to remote displays or data loggers.
Sensor transmitters are available in either NEMA 4X or explosion-proof versions and can be supplied with exclusive Auto-Test automatic sensor testing system, greatly reducing operator testing requirements.

Sensing modules consist of an electrochemical gas diffusion sensor and a solid state memory assembly. Our electrochemical sensors provide excellent response time, maximum selectivity, and superior temperature stability for reliable gas sensing in a wide range of environments. The companion memory assembly stores operational information and calibration constants, along with gas sensor identification, sensing module range, and software revision level. Complete sensing modules are housed in convenient snap-in packages that mate easily with UniSens transmitters. This unique combination of sensor and memory lets you calibrate sensing modules with any UniSens transmitter. So instead of calibrating in the field, you can bench calibrate sensing modules with a spare transmitter; once the sensors are snapped into a field transmitter, their calibration constants upload automatically.
Powered by an ordinary C cell, the Sensor Keeper maintains sensors in stable operating condition for up to 6 months. Sensor Keepers are useful not just for transporting sensors to and from the field, but for keeping calibrated spares on the shelf. They also let us calibrate sensors at the factory, and ship them for immediate installation and use.

The UniSens microcomputer-controlled transmitter provides a local digital display and a 4-20 mA analog output proportional to gas concentration. It works with any of our sensing modules, configuring its own display and output range automatically based on data read from the module's memory. Zero and calibration data is also read into memory, so the transmitter is automatically calibrated when it's connected to a calibrated module. Magnetic controls on the front of the transmitter allow field calibration, manual activation of the Auto-Test feature (if installed), and review of sensing module data including gas type, range, and number of successful Auto-Tests. The transmitter can also act as an analog output simulator to facilitate complete loop testing. Outputs of 4.0,12.0, and 20.0 mA are selectable via the front panel, along with a trouble signal of 3.6 mA. The transmitter is housed in a durable cast- aluminum shell with an 11-pin octal base for easy installation and removal. And since UniSens transmitters are 100% interchangeable, one unit can serve as a backup for every type of gas in use
